Identifying Signs of Clogged Filters in AC
Inspect filter regularly. A visible layer of dust indicates blockage, affecting airflow. Clean or replace immediately to prevent further issues.
Listen for unusual sounds. If your unit emits struggling noises, it may suggest compressor strain due to restricted circulation.
Watch for coil freezing. If you notice ice forming on components, it points to insufficient airflow, often from a compromised filter.
Check energy bills. A spike may indicate malfunction. Increased power consumption often correlates with clogged filters demanding more from the system.
- Weak airflow feels inadequate.
- Unpleasant odors signal mold or dust accumulation.
- Frequent cycling suggests the unit is overworking.
Maintain basics: regular cleaning schedules. Schedule professional check-ups yearly to keep components in top shape.
Observe changing temperatures. If it’s harder to achieve desired comfort levels, filter issues could be the culprit.
Nip problems in the bud. Addressing these signs promptly enhances system performance, prolonging unit life.

Regular Maintenance Tips for Air Filter Replacement
Change air filters every 1 to 3 months based on usage. Frequent replacements prevent buildup and enhance airflow, minimizing compressor strain.
Inspect and clean filters more often if pets are present. Pet hair accumulates quickly, leading to reduced efficiency and potential issues like coil freezing.
Check compatibility of the new filtration element with the system. Using the correct size and type ensures optimal performance and prevents unnecessary wear on components.
| Filter Type | Change Interval | Notes |
|---|---|---|
| Fiberglass | 1 month | Low efficiency, often leading to higher strain. |
| Pleated | 3 months | Better filtration, longer lifespan. |
| HEPA | 6 months | High efficiency, great for allergies. |
Regularly inspect the filter for dirt and debris buildup. A dirty filter can restrict airflow, leading to increased energy consumption and potential equipment failure.
Seasonal checkups are beneficial. Schedule a technician visit each spring and fall to ensure system is operating efficiently and the filter is in good shape.

Long-term Consequences of Neglecting Filter Cleanliness
Regular maintenance of filters is crucial; neglect often leads to significant coil freezing. A blocked filter hinders airflow, causing the coils to become excessively cold, which can result in ice formation. This not only impairs the cooling efficiency but also triggers additional issues throughout the system.
Additionally, ignoring filter hygiene puts unnecessary strain on the compressor, potentially leading to premature failure. The unit works harder to compensate for reduced airflow, which contributes to energy waste and increases utility bills. How do dirty air filters affect the performance of my air conditioning system?
Dirty air filters restrict airflow, making it difficult for your air conditioning system to circulate air effectively. This can lead to reduced cooling efficiency, forcing the system to work harder and potentially causing increased wear and tear on the components.
What are the signs that my AC filter needs to be replaced?
Common signs include reduced airflow from the vents, increased energy bills, and frequent system cycling. You might also notice a dusty environment or unpleasant odors coming from the AC. If it has been a few months since the last change, it’s probably time to check the filter.
How often should I change my AC air filters to ensure longevity?
Typically, it’s recommended to change air filters every 1 to 3 months, depending on usage and type of filter. For households with pets or high dust levels, more frequent changes may be necessary to maintain optimal performance and efficiency.
Can a dirty air filter lead to expensive repairs for my AC unit?
Yes, neglecting to change a dirty air filter can lead to various issues, such as overheating, frozen coils, or compressor failure. These problems can result in costly repairs and reduce the overall lifespan of your AC unit.
What is the best type of air filter for maximizing my AC’s lifespan?
The best type of air filter can vary based on your specific needs, but high-efficiency particulate air (HEPA) filters or pleated filters are often recommended. They trap more dust and allergens, promoting better air quality and reducing strain on your system.
